Adyen's Acquisition Boost

Adyen, the Dutch payments group, is soaring today after raising its revenue growth guidance. The company's first acquisitions are paying off, with net revenue up 19% for the first half of the year. This move highlights the growing importance of the payments sector and the potential for further consolidation. Personally, I think Adyen's success could spark a wave of M&A activity in this space.

Signs of Supply Relief

In the energy and fertilizer sectors, there are signs that the war-driven supply squeeze is easing. Middle Eastern crude is reaching US shores, and Indian urea offers have dropped. While this provides some near-term relief, the durability of this trend is uncertain due to ongoing disruptions in the Strait of Hormuz and stalled peace talks. Trump's Tariff Victory

A US trade court has upheld Trump's removal of the 'de minimis' exemption for goods valued at US$800 or less. This decision is a win for the administration's trade agenda, despite other legal setbacks. The impact of this ruling on low-cost imports and consumer prices is something to watch closely.

Korean Chip Rally

South Korean stocks are on a roll, with the Kospi index gaining over 22% in just 10 days. This revival is driven by the AI trade and expectations of shareholder return plans from Samsung and SK Hynix. However, the market remains volatile, with regulatory curbs and margin debt management playing a stabilizing role.

US Bond Sale and Deficit Concerns

The US Treasury's 30-year bond sale at the highest yield since 2001 is a notable development. This reflects the increasing cost of funding the swelling US deficit. Fitch's rating maintenance, despite warning of a widening fiscal deficit in 2026, adds to the complexity of the situation. It's a delicate dance between market demand and economic realities.
